How they compare
Chile currently reports 64.58 t against 61.27 t in Hungary, a difference of 3.31 t.
That makes Chile's figure about 1.1 times Hungary's.
The two have swapped places 6 times across 18 shared years of data; in 2004 it was Chile ahead.
Chile ranks 66th and Hungary ranks 67th of 107 countries.
Across the 3 decades both report, Chile averaged higher in 1 and Hungary in 2.

About this data
The Fertilizers by Product dataset contains information on the Production, Trade and Agriculture Use of inorganic (chemical or mineral) fertilizers products. The fertilizer statistics data are for a set of 23 product categories. Both straight and compound fertilizers are included.
